Understanding the Lightweight Design of the Mitsubishi Mirage

The Mitsubishi Mirage’s lightweight design is achieved through the use of advanced materials, streamlined engineering, and a compact frame that balances strength with minimal mass. By reducing the vehicle’s overall weight, Mitsubishi engineers have crafted a car that demands less power to move, resulting in enhanced performance metrics that are particularly advantageous in city driving conditions. The Mirage typically weighs around 1,900 pounds, significantly lighter than many other subcompact cars in its class.

This reduction in weight is not just about shedding pounds; it influences nearly every aspect of the car’s performance, from fuel consumption to handling dynamics, and even maintenance requirements. Lightweight design is a key factor that allows the Mirage to deliver an outstanding blend of economy and drivability without compromising safety or comfort.

Enhanced Fuel Efficiency: Saving Money and the Environment

One of the most compelling advantages of the Mirage’s lightweight construction is its positive impact on fuel efficiency. Because the engine has less mass to propel, it operates with less strain, which translates directly into better miles per gallon (MPG). On average, the Mitsubishi Mirage achieves fuel economy ratings of approximately 36 MPG in the city and up to 43 MPG on the highway, figures that put it among the leaders in the subcompact segment.

In urban settings, where frequent acceleration and braking are inevitable, the Mirage’s lightweight frame helps minimize fuel consumption during stop-and-go traffic. This not only reduces operating costs for drivers but also contributes to lower greenhouse gas emissions, supporting greener city living. For commuters who rack up significant mileage daily, these savings can add up substantially over the years, making the Mirage an economical choice both upfront and in the long term.

Improved Maneuverability and Handling in Tight Urban Spaces

The lightweight nature of the Mitsubishi Mirage directly contributes to its nimble handling characteristics, which are essential for driving in crowded city streets. With less mass to control, drivers can enjoy sharper steering response and quicker reaction times. This enhanced agility is crucial when navigating through narrow lanes, avoiding obstacles, or making sudden lane changes during rush hour.

The Mirage’s low curb weight also improves its acceleration from a stop, enabling drivers to merge smoothly into fast-moving traffic or quickly clear intersections. This responsiveness reduces driver stress and enhances safety, especially for less experienced urban drivers who need confidence behind the wheel.

Additionally, the Mirage’s compact dimensions combined with its lightweight chassis make parking in tight spots much easier. Whether parallel parking on a busy street or squeezing into a crowded lot, the car’s manageable size and light feel reduce the effort and precision required, saving time and frustration.

Handling Features Enhanced by Lightweight Design

  • Reduced Inertia: Less weight means the car changes direction more easily, improving cornering and maneuverability.
  • Better Braking Performance: The brakes have less mass to stop, leading to shorter stopping distances and improved safety.
  • Improved Suspension Response: The suspension system can work more efficiently, offering a smoother ride over uneven city roads.

Reduced Wear and Tear

The lower mass means less stress on critical components such as brakes, tires, and suspension parts. Drivers can expect longer intervals between maintenance for these items, which reduces overall ownership costs. For example, brake pads tend to last longer because the brakes do not need to dissipate as much kinetic energy when slowing a lighter vehicle.

Performance Modifications and Customization Opportunities

For enthusiasts interested in further enhancing the Mitsubishi Mirage’s capabilities, the lightweight platform offers a solid foundation for performance tuning and modifications. Because the car is already optimized for efficiency and agility, aftermarket modifications can focus on improving power output, suspension tuning, and aesthetic upgrades without compromising its inherent advantages.

  • Engine Tuning: ECU remapping or cold air intake additions can increase horsepower and torque, improving acceleration while maintaining fuel efficiency.
  • Suspension Upgrades: Installing sport-tuned shocks and struts can enhance handling precision for spirited urban driving.
  • Lightweight Wheels and Tires: Replacing stock wheels with lightweight alloys reduces unsprung weight, improving ride quality and responsiveness.
  • Aerodynamic Enhancements: Adding subtle body kits or spoilers can improve airflow and stability at higher speeds.

These modifications allow owners to tailor their Mirage to their driving preferences while preserving the core benefits of its lightweight design.
